Notables: Medical Research

Movers & Makers reached out this month to regional organizations working in the field of medical research. We asked them to help us showcase their notables as part of M&M’s continuing effort to recognize individuals making a difference in medical research and in Greater Cincinnati’s nonprofit ecosystem.

Mary Kate Gehret, Wood Hudson

Mary Kate Gehret, Ph.D., brings a rare combination of scientific focus and enthusiasm to cancer research. As a staff scientist at Wood Hudson Cancer Research Laboratory, she can spend hours thinking about her experiments and still have the energy to light up a room afterward. When she is not in the lab, she is usually with friends, family or her husband, though it is widely understood that her true bosses are her wonderfully chaotic feline crew.

Her excitement for science carries over into everything she does, especially when it comes to mentoring young minds. She looks forward to working with students in the Undergraduate Research Education Program at Wood Hudson, where her curiosity and humor make learning engaging to inspire the next generation of researchers and clinicians. Whether she is analyzing data or wrangling cats, Gehret shows up fully, making science fun for everyone around her.

Brian J. Chilelli, Mercy Health

Dr. Brian J. Chilelli is a board-certified orthopaedic surgeon specializing in complex knee surgery, with expertise in cartilage restoration, knee preservation and ligament reconstruction. He serves as an orthopaedic surgeon at Mercy Health and is a faculty member at the Cincinnati Sports Medicine and Orthopaedic Center fellowship. Chilelli completed his orthopaedic surgery residency at Northwestern University Feinberg School of Medicine, followed by a sports medicine fellowship
at Brigham and Women’s Hospital, Harvard Medical School.

His clinical interests include advanced cartilage repair techniques, osteotomies, cartilage transplantation and orthobiologics. Chilelli is an active researcher and educator, contributing extensively to orthopaedic literature and national courses. He has adopted innovative technology, serving as the first surgeon in Cincinnati to utilize the CartiHeal implant for cartilage repair. He will also take part in a Phase III multicenter FDA clinical trial evaluating a novel stem cell-based therapy, CartiStem, for cartilage damage.

Christin Godale, LifeSciKY

Christin Godale, Ph.D., is helping position the region as an emerging hub for life sciences innovation. As executive director of LifeSciKY, she is building dedicated infrastructure to support independent early-stage life science companies, connecting founders, researchers and industry partners to accelerate growth.

Under Godale’s leadership, LifeSciKY launched a 15,000-square-foot lab in Covington that has already attracted multiple startups and its first international company, Mitsui Chemicals, to the region, serving as early proof of momentum.

Godale’s background in neuroscience and venture investing informs her hands-on approach to supporting founders, while her work developing fellowships and university partnerships is creating a pipeline for future innovators. She is a dedicated epilepsy advocate, raising awareness and supporting research to improve treatments and patient outcomes.

Takanori Takebe, Cincinnati Children’s

Takanori Takebe, M.D., Ph.D., is redefining what’s possible in regenerative medicine, growing miniature human organs from stem cells and moving them toward real-world therapies for children with life-threatening disease. He is an associate professor and is director of commercial innovation at the Center for Stem Cell and Organoid Research and Medicine. At just 39, he was named to the 2026 TIME100 Health list, recognized for pioneering organoid medicine and advancing bold ideas like enteral “rectal” ventilation, which earned his team a satirical Ig Nobel Prize in 2024. Takebe’s work stands out for its urgency: His lab has engineered multi-zonal liver organoids, connected multi-organ systems and scalable platforms to replace damaged organs and accelerate drug discovery. He originally planned to become a transplant surgeon; witnessing the shortage of donor organs pushed him to grow new ones instead. That pivot captures Takebe’s humanity: a scientist driven not just by curiosity, but by the children waiting for solutions.

Francisco Romo-Nava, Lindner Center of Hope

Romo-Nava is associate chief research officer at the Lindner Center of Hope and associate professor at the University of Cincinnati Department of Psychiatry and Behavioral Neurosciences. He has received several academic distinctions, including a NARSAD Young Investigator Award by the Brain and Behavior Research Foundation, grants from the National Institutes of Health, and is a research co-lead for Breakthrough Discoveries for thriving with Bipolar Disorder (BD2) Integrated Network site. 

He is also a physician-scientist studying the role of brain-body interaction networks in the context of psychiatric disorders, and is breaking new ground with studies of the circadian system and spinal interoceptive pathways in mood and eating disorders. He is the inventor of a promising new intervention, spinal cord stimulation, which is now patented for treating psychiatric disorders. 

Dr. Francisco Romo-Nava is a proud husband and dad. He likes to spend time riding a bike with his kids and hiking around the trails of the Cincinnati Nature Center or visiting children’s museums with his family.
